Rajitha Basnayake Appointed to Cargills Bank Board 📈
Cargills Bank has announced the appointment of Rajitha Basnayake as an Independent Non-Executive Director to its Board, effective January 2026. This move highlights the bank's focus on strengthening its ICT and Digital Transformation governance to support long-term business strategies. • Expertise & Background: Basnayake is a veteran Information Technology professional and management consultant with over 35 years of experience. His career spans leadership in mission-critical ICT and business process transformation across diverse sectors, including Financial Services, FMCG, and Retail. • Key Professional Highlights: • Previously served as a Senior Independent Director at Asia Asset Finance PLC. • Former Director of Advisory Services at Ernst and Young Sri Lanka, providing ICT and business consultancy for major public and private projects. • Held senior management roles at Asia Capital Group (CIO), The Lion Brewery, and Richard Pieris Distributors. • Academic Credentials: He holds a Master’s in IT from Keele University (UK) and is a Chartered Member of the British Computer Society. This appointment comes as Cargills Bank continues its growth trajectory, recently reporting a 97% YoY increase in Profit After Tax (Rs. 313 Mn) for 9M 2025 and moving forward with a Rs. 2.5 Bn rights issue to fuel its lending expansion.

Dr. Parakrama Dissanayake Appointed Presidential Adviser on Maritime & Logistics ⚓
President Anura Kumara Dissanayake has appointed Dr. Mahinda Parakrama Dissanayake as the Adviser to the President on Maritime, Ports and Logistics with immediate effect. The appointment is on an honorary basis to support the national objective of positioning Sri Lanka as a global logistics hub. • Current Leadership: Dr. Dissanayake serves as the Deputy Chairman and Managing Director of Aitken Spence PLC. • Government & Public Sector Experience: He previously served as Secretary to the Ministry of Ports and Shipping and has twice chaired the Sri Lanka Ports Authority (SLPA). • Strategic Oversight: His experience includes leadership roles at the Jaya Container Terminal, Hambantota International Port Services, and board positions at SAGT and CICT. • Global Credentials: He was the first non-British International President of the Institute of Chartered Shipbrokers (UK) and has served as a shipping expert for UNCTAD. The appointment aims to leverage Sri Lanka's strategic geographical location to drive economic growth through the maritime and logistics sectors, which are vital for employment and foreign exchange earnings.

Sri Lankan-Born Astrophysicist Dr. Ray Jayawardhana Appointed 10th President of Caltech 🎓
• The Appointment: Dr. Ray Jayawardhana has been named the 10th President of the California Institute of Technology (Caltech), effective July 1, 2026. He is the first Sri Lankan-born academic to lead the prestigious 105-year-old institution. • Professional Background: He currently serves as the Provost of Johns Hopkins University, overseeing 10 schools and key initiatives like the Data Science and AI Institute. His leadership has been central to interdisciplinary research and global academic outreach. • Scientific Achievement: A world-renowned astrophysicist, Dr. Jayawardhana specializes in exoplanets and star formation. He has co-authored 180+ refereed papers with over 10,000 citations. He is a core team member for the James Webb Space Telescope’s NIRISS instrument. • Sri Lankan Roots: His interest in space began in his childhood in Sri Lanka, fueled by stargazing with his father. He has since become a major voice in science communication, authoring several books including Strange New Worlds and Neutrino Hunters. • Economic & Global Impact: This high-profile appointment highlights the global reach of the Sri Lankan diaspora in ICT/BPM, Science, and Education sectors, reinforcing the country's potential for high-level intellectual exports. 📈 • Vision for Caltech: Jayawardhana plans to focus on bold investments in the Jet Propulsion Laboratory (JPL), global observatories, and expanding public engagement with science.
Late Lakshman Balasuriya: A Legacy of Integrity in Finance 📈
The Sri Lankan financial community mourns the passing of Lakshman Balasuriya, the long-standing leader of Senkadagala Finance PLC. Known for his humility and ethical leadership, his career spanned over four decades in the non-banking financial institution (NBFI) sector. • Professional Legacy: Served as Managing Director and CEO of Senkadagala Finance PLC from 1981 until 2024. Following his retirement as MD upon reaching age 70, he continued to serve as CEO until his demise in December 2025. • Sector Impact: Under his visionary leadership, the institution grew into one of Sri Lanka’s largest licensed finance companies, expanding to a network of 110 branches across all nine provinces. • Financial Stewardship: Managed a diverse portfolio including leasing, pawn brokering, and deposit mobilization. As of his passing, he held a significant interest of over 5.9 million ordinary voting shares in the company. • Corporate Values: Renowned for a "policy-first" approach, he advocated for professional dignity in the finance and banking industry, eschewing personal security and material displays of wealth despite his high-ranking status. • Personal Influence: Recognized by peers and family as a "true gentleman" who prioritized privacy, humility, and mentorship, profoundly impacting the next generation of leaders in Sri Lanka’s financial services sector.

Warren Buffett Retiring as Berkshire CEO After 60+ Years 📈
• Value investing icon Warren Buffett (95) will step down as CEO of Berkshire Hathaway on 31 December 2025, ending a leadership tenure spanning more than 60 years. • Vice-Chairman Greg Abel is set to assume the CEO role on 1 January 2026. Buffett will stay on as the company's Board Chairman. • Buffett built the company into a US conglomerate now valued at approximately US$ 880 Bn, with major holdings in insurance, rail, utilities, energy, retail, and manufacturing. • Berkshire Hathaway holds a massive corporate cash reserve of roughly US$ 382 Bn, the largest corporate cash position in the US. • Apple Inc. remains the company’s biggest equity holding despite recent reductions. • The "Oracle of Omaha's" lifetime charitable giving has surpassed US$ 60 Bn.

⚖️ ICT Legal Veteran Jayantha Fernando Joins LOLC Finance Board
• LOLC Finance PLC has appointed Jayantha Fernando, a senior Legal expert specializing in Telecommunications and IT Law, as a Non-Executive Independent Director. • Fernando brings nearly 30 years of experience in key tech legal areas, including Digital Transactions, Digital Payments, Data Protection, Cybercrime, and AI. • Key National Contributions: • Led the strategy to formulate and enact Sri Lanka’s Personal Data Protection Act (PDPA) No. 09 of 2022, which is the first comprehensive data privacy legislation in South Asia. • Oversaw the drafting of the Electronic Transactions Act and the Computer Crimes Act while at the ICT Agency (ICTA). • Led Sri Lanka's entry to the Budapest Cybercrime Convention, becoming the first South East Asian elected to its global Board.

🧑💼 CBSL Appoints Two New Deputy Governors
• In terms of the Central Bank of Sri Lanka Act, No. 16 of 2023, the Minister of Finance has appointed two new Deputy Governors, effective late October/early November 2025. • Appointees & Effective Dates: • Dr. C Amarasekara (Former Assistant Governor): Effective 24.10.2025. • Mr. K G P Sirikumara (Former Assistant Governor): Effective 03.11.2025. • Key Experience Highlights: • Dr. Amarasekara: Over 22 years experience. Specialises in monetary policy and macroeconomic research. Previously served as Alternate Executive Director at the IMF (Jan 2022-Feb 2024) and oversaw Economic Research and Market Operations. • Mr. Sirikumara: Over 25 years experience. Previously oversaw Public Debt Management, Financial Sector Resolution, and Currency Management. Instrumental in introducing law reforms in the banking/financial sector and anti-money laundering frameworks. Both are Attorneys-at-Law.
🏏 SL Cricket Selection Panel Term Ends in December 🏏
• The two-year term of the current Sri Lanka Cricket (SLC) selection committee, chaired by Upul Tharanga, is set to conclude in December. • SLC has initiated the standard process, requesting stakeholders to nominate names for the new panel within a two-week period. The SLC Executive Committee will forward 10 suitable candidates to the Minister of Sports for the final appointment. • The committee was appointed after the 2023 ICC CWC failure, and alongside Head Coach Sanath Jayasuriya, has overseen significant improvement: • ODIs: Strong 68% win rate (P25, W17). Currently ranked 4th. • Tests: 50% win rate (P14, W7). Currently ranked 6th. • T20Is: 45.45% win rate (P33, W15). Ranked 8th. • The new (or partially retained) panel will likely pick the squad for the next ICC T20 World Cup (hosted by India/Sri Lanka, Feb-Mar 2026). • Head Coach Sanath Jayasuriya's contract, which expires on March 31, 2026, will also come up for review after the T20 World Cup.

Central Bank of Sri Lanka (CBSL) Governing Board Appointment ⚖️
• H.E. the President has appointed Mr. Maithri Evan Wickremesinghe, P.C. as a member of the Central Bank of Sri Lanka (CBSL) Governing Board (GB), effective 02.10.2025. • He succeeds Mr. Rajeev Amarasuriya in this role. • The GB is tasked under the CBSL Act, No. 16 of 2023, with overseeing the administration, management, and determination of general policies for the CBSL. All GB members also serve on the Monetary Policy Board. • Profile Highlights: • Mr. Wickremesinghe is a President's Counsel (P.C.), a Fellow of the Chartered Institute of Management Accountants (UK), and holds an Honours Degree in Law from the University of Colombo. • He is an active practicing lawyer and arbitrator in national and international proceedings. • His previous experience includes serving as a Senior Independent Director of a listed commercial bank (chairing its Audit Review and Nominations Committees) and an Independent Director of a listed conglomerate. • He currently serves as an Independent Non-Executive Director of Convenience Foods Lanka PLC.
